The ERJPA3F1303V is a high-reliability, anti-surge thick film chip resistor designed for precise applications requiring high voltage capacity. It features a resistance tolerance of ±1%, a TCR of +100 (x 10%), and a maximum limiting element voltage of 150 V. Suitable for both reflow and flow soldering, it offers a power rating of 0.33 W in a compact 0603 inch size. Its construction includes a metal glaze thick film resistive element and three layers of electrodes, meeting IEC 60115-8, JIS C 5201-8 standards, and is compliant with AEC-Q200 and RoHS directives. Ideal for high precision and demanding electrical environments.
Construction: Metal glaze thick film element with three layers of electrodes
Standards: IEC 60115-8, JIS C 5201-8
Compliance: AEC-Q200, RoHS
Operating Temperature: -55°C to +155°C
Resistance Range: 10Ω to 1MΩ
Appearance: Surface-mount, compact package suitable for high-density PCB layouts
Soldering: Compatible with reflow and flow soldering processes
